Police confiscated heroin, cocaine and meth from an alleged shoplifter Monday afternoon.

Elko Police Capt. Ty Trouten said officers were called to Auto Zone on Mountain City Highway at approximately 1:50 p.m. April 30 on a report of a man stealing items from the store.

Michael D. Overholser, 40, was stopped by police as he was leaving in his vehicle.

Elko Combined Narcotics Unit served a search warrant on the vehicle. Trouten said they recovered approximately 89 grams of heroin, 12 grams of cocaine, and 7 grams of methamphetamine.

Overholser, whose address was listed as Burley, Idaho, was booked into the Elko County Jail on multiple charges of possession of a controlled substance, possession with intent to sell a controlled substance, and trafficking a controlled substance.

His bail was listed at $395,000
